Market Segmentation
By Therapy Type:
Whole-Body Cryotherapy (WBC): Involves exposing the entire body to extremely cold temperatures, primarily used for pain relief, muscle recovery, and overall wellness.
Localized Cryotherapy: Targets specific body parts, commonly used in dermatology and pain management.
Cryosurgery: Utilizes extreme cold to destroy abnormal tissues, widely applied in oncology and dermatology.
By Application:
Oncology: Cryotherapy is employed to treat various cancers by freezing and destroying malignant tissues.The Business Research Company
Cardiology: Used in procedures like cryoablation to treat cardiac arrhythmias.
Dermatology: Applied to remove skin lesions, warts, and treat other skin conditions.
Pain Management: Utilized to alleviate chronic pain conditions and facilitate muscle recovery.
Beauty and Wellness: Incorporated in aesthetic treatments for skin rejuvenation and weight loss.
By End-User:
Hospitals and Specialty Clinics: Major providers of cryotherapy treatments for various medical conditions.
Ambulatory Surgical Centers: Offer cryotherapy procedures on an outpatient basis.
Fitness and Sports Centers: Provide cryotherapy services for muscle recovery and performance enhancement.
Spas and Wellness Centers: Offer cryotherapy for beauty and general wellness purposes.
